[CC'd Cornelius Weig who added the code you're modifying] If I'm reading this correctly this is a good patch but quite a bad explanation of what we're changing. The problem here is not that it's cumbersome to translate this using strbuf, but that we're injecting i18n'd messages into the reflog, so e.g. someone with a Chinese locale creating a tag in a shared repo will cause the Chinese i18n message to be inserted into the reflog, and then someone with e.g. a German or English locale will see the Chinese messages when they run "git reflog". That's a very bad thing, and in some ways worse than translating plumbing messages, because here we're injecting i18n'd messages into the on-disk format. Luckily this hasn't made it into 2.13 yet.
